Letters to a Pre-Scientist is dedicated to fostering the next generation of STEM professionals through innovative educational programs. By connecting students with real-world scientists, Letters to a Pre-Scientist aims to demystify STEM careers and empower students from all backgrounds to envision themselves as future leaders in science, technology, engineering, and mathematics.

The organization achieves its mission through a unique snail mail pen pal program, facilitated by dedicated science teachers. This program pairs students, particularly those in low-income communities across the U.S., with STEM professional volunteers from around the globe. These pen pal relationships offer invaluable mentorship and guidance, helping students to explore higher education, navigate career paths, and overcome obstacles in their academic journeys.

Letters to a Pre-Scientist is headquartered in Amherst, Massachusetts, operating primarily remotely at Amherst, Massachusetts 01002, US. Letters to a Pre-Scientist is committed to diversity and inclusion, ensuring that students connect with scientists from diverse backgrounds and fields. Letters to a Pre-Scientist believes that every student deserves the opportunity to discover their potential in STEM.
